Δημοσιεύτηκε: 12 Ιαν 2013, 17:50
Προσπαθώ να κάνω ένα πρόγραμμα και μεσα στα πολλά πρέπει να κάνω και το ακόλουθο που αντιμετωπίζω ένα πρόβλημα:
Θέλω να διαβάζω από το χρήστη 5 σειρές των 5 αριθμών.. Για παράδειγμα θέλω να μου δίνει ο χρήστης το ακόλουθο:
12345
45678
48952
45685
12323
(προτέποντάς τον εγώ σε κάθε σειρά να μου δώσει πέντε αριθμούς) Έγραψα το παρακάτω..
Πως μπορώ να ελέγχω αν ο χρήστης θα δώσει 5 αριθμούς σε κάθε σειρά; Αν δώσει παραπανω θα του δίνω πχ ένα printf οτι εκανε λαθος
Ευχαριστώ!
Θέλω να διαβάζω από το χρήστη 5 σειρές των 5 αριθμών.. Για παράδειγμα θέλω να μου δίνει ο χρήστης το ακόλουθο:
12345
45678
48952
45685
12323
(προτέποντάς τον εγώ σε κάθε σειρά να μου δώσει πέντε αριθμούς) Έγραψα το παρακάτω..
- Κώδικας: Επιλογή όλων
int array[5][5];
for(i=0;i<5;i++)
{
printf("line %d : ", i+1);
for(j=0;j<5;j++)
{
scanf("%1d", &array[i][j]);
}
}
Πως μπορώ να ελέγχω αν ο χρήστης θα δώσει 5 αριθμούς σε κάθε σειρά; Αν δώσει παραπανω θα του δίνω πχ ένα printf οτι εκανε λαθος
Ευχαριστώ!